The size of Kingston is approximately 6.7 square kilometres. It has 30 parks covering nearly 17.2% of total area. The population of Kingston in 2016 was 10539 people. By 2021 the population was 10506 showing a population decline of 0.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Kingston is 20-29 years. Households in Kingston are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Kingston work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 45.50% of the homes in Kingston were owner-occupied compared with 47.50% in 2016.
